    iTunes will display a cover in many of it's views provided at least one track from the album has embedded artwork. The iPod appears to load only the artwork from track one to create the cover flow and album views which means that it can sometimes fail to display art for albums even when you can see the art in iTunes. Further, when tracks are played on the iPod, artwork is displayed if and only if it exisits in the currently playing track, so track one may show art while track two does not.
    To find all the tracks without artwork so that you can update them you can try http://www.stum.de/itunes-find-tracks-without-artwork/ for Windows or http://dougscripts.com/itunes/scripts/scripts13.php for Macs. If you're using Google or other FWSE to locate suitable images they should be jpg's and ideally square, 320x320 pixels or above and borderless to give the best results in the various menus.

    Hey, if you want to see something REALLY horrible, take a look at some Photoshop images saved with Photoshop's custom thumbs from the 1990s. I think those were 32x32, and on my old 7100 it was way cool--Windows 95 didn't even HAVE custom thumbs. Here's what the old thumbs look like in icon view at a mere 128 setting (not even the possible giant size available in Cover Flow):
    I remember when Macs moved to the 128x128 thumbs, and how gorgeous and detailed they looked, compared to the old ones. And, of course, eventually a Photoshop update moved to that sized custom thumbs as well. Apple is now in the process of moving to 512x512 custom thumbs, or you can have NO custom thumbs and just let the Finder draw thumbs "on the fly" for you. No doubt Adobe will also eventually update to the bigger thumbs, but right now they are still at 128x128, and if an item has a custom thumb Finder assumes that's what you want to use and displays them. If you have the size of the Cover Flow section of the Finder window set to take advantage of Apple's 512 thumbs they will look lovely, but Adobe's custom thumbs will be blown up by a factor of 4 and look terrible. You can either shrink the Cover Flow section down to the optimum size for the custom thumbs, or you can strip them off and let Finder draw them. You can even use an Automator workflow to replace them with thumbs drawn by the system rather than by Photoshop (which is what I've been doing).

    For the instances where you are getting multiple album art showing in Cover Flow, are those songs from a compilation album? If the artist name isn't exactly the same for each song, iTunes will list them individually. You will have to: identify them as a compilation or alter the tag info or use the Sorting option to group them together.
